Dr Charles S. Bryan joins Ethics Talk to discuss his article: “Virtue Ethics and Postponing Human Extinction.”

Access the transcript and read the article

Charles S. Bryan, MD is the Heyward Gibbes Distinguished Professor Emeritus of Internal Medicine at the University of South Carolina School of Medicine Columbia. He formerly served as chair of the Department of Medicine and director of the Center for Bioethics and Medical Humanities at the University of South Carolina. His publications are mainly in the areas of infectious diseases, medical history, and medical biography, with particular interest in Sir William Osler.
